60 Second Review of…

Anne McCaffrey's Freedom: First Resistance

Tom's Review: This game has it all! Tedious missions, a dopey story, and unmanageable combat. What more do you want? How about flat graphics? Uninteresting levels? An awkward save and reload system? But wait, there's more! You're forced to listen to reams and reams of spoken dialogue. Because the game is about a race of alien cats who invade Earth, my favorite part of this game was pretending I was a writer for the late PC Accelerator and trying to think up some sophomoric joke about pussy taking over the world. My next favorite part of Freedom was uninstalling it, at which point I stopped trying to think up a joke about pussy taking over the world. There is absolutely nothing — let me repeat — nothing to recommend this game. When it hits the bargain bins any day now, it will make a great booby prize. Pick up a few $1.99 copies next month to dismay your friends and confound your enemies.
